Schladenhauffen, Candace Sue was born on December 6, 1956 in Fort Wayne, Indiana, United States. Daughter of Jack Eldon and Patricia Ruth Smith.
Student, Wittenberg University, 1975—1978. Diploma in Respiratory Therapy, Northwestern University, 1984. Bachelor of Science in General Studies, Indiana University, 1997.
Master of Science in Biology, Purdue University, 2004.
Staff therapist Natrona County Hospital, Casper, Wyoming, 1984, Baptist Hospital, Pensacola, Florida, 1985. Clinical supervisor Lutheran Hospital of Indiana, Fort Wayne, 1985—1989, cardiopulmonary diagnostics coordinator, 1989—1992, adult critical care team leader, 1992—1993. Respiratory care program chair Ivy Tech State College, 1994—2000, chair division health science, since 2000.
Member advisory board Anthis Career Center, Fort Wayne, since 2000, EduCare, Fort Wayne, since 2000. Asthma educators' certified planning American Library Association, Fort Wayne, since 1999. Member advisory board Heartland Hospice, since 2003.
Member of House of Delegates, American Lung Association, Indiana Society Respiratory Care (chapter director 1996-1999), American Association Respiratory Care, Lambda Beta.
Married Warren Douglas Schladenhauffen, March 18, 1986. Married Barry John Brocker, October 7, 1978 (divorced December 29, 1982).
